Obstetric ultrasonography, or prenatal ultrasound, is the use of medical ultrasonography in pregnancy, in which sound waves are used to create real-time visual images of the developing embryo or fetus in the uterus (womb). The procedure is a standard part of prenatal care in many countries, as it can provide a variety of information about the health of the mother, the timing and progress of . . As ultrasound became a widely available and popular investigation, it contributed heavily to several population screening programs that took place between the late 70's and the 90's. The first was the Maternal serum alpha-feto protein (MSAFP) screening programs for the detection of neurotube defects (NTD).
